Video-assisted thoracoscopic surgery for primary spontaneous pneumothorax in children

Abstract: VATS is a safe and effective procedure for PSP in children. However, the risk of recurrence is increased in children and it is related to the formation of new bullae.

“…In fact, VATS is associated with lower morbidity, decreased pain, and shorter hospital stays. 5,[14][15][16] Considering the higher rate of recurrence, especially in paediatric PSP, determining the predictive factors of recurrence could be useful for selecting patients who may benefit from early surgical referral to prevent recurrence and reduce hospital stays.…”

“…Currently, video-assisted thoracoscopy (VATS) has become an increasingly important tool in pediatric surgery. It has been mainly used for lung biopsy and for the treatment of empyema and recurrent pneumothorax [79]. Several published reports suggest thoracoscopic pulmonary resections, including segmentectomy and lobectomy is safe, with the potential advantage of shorter hospital stay, quicker recovery, and better cosmetic result treatment modality [1012].…”
